DirectorOTTCR TflilootaTT-aiaaiioT* GOVERNMENT SERVICES CENTER 540 WEST FIR AVENUE FERGUS FALLS, MN 56537 218-998-8095 FAX: 218-998-8112 Board of Adjustment Findings of Fact and Decision Applicant:Terry Weckerly Address/Parcel No. 48714 Alder Dr. / 55000220158000 & 55000990677000 Requested Variance: Remove existing 26 x 12 Patio and replace with 26 x 12 x 16 addition to dwelling being 88 feet from the OHWL. Standard setback is 100 feet. Asking for a variance of 12 feet. Otter Tail County Ordinance: X Shoreland Mgmt. □ Sanitation. □ Subdivision. DWECS □ Dock & Riparian Use □ Setback Ord. Ordinance Section Citation: III. 4. A. A variance may be granted only where the strict enforcement of county land use controls will result in a "practical difficulty". A determination that a practical difficulty exists is based upon consideration of the following criteria: The applicant identified the following practical difficulty: The existing deck has been there since 2009 and would like to have an enclosed sun-room, this improvement should not impede the view of the neighbors. No recommendations Applicable Ordinances/Statutes SHORELAND MANAGEMENT ORDINANCE SECTION IV,SUBP. 12 D. Repair and/or replacement of an existing Non-Conforming building or structure is permitted only in accordance with Minnesota Statute 394.36 MINNESOTA STATUTE 394.36 Subd. 4,Nonconformities; certain classes of property. This subdivision applies to homestead and nonhomestead residential real estate and seasonal residential real estate occupied for recreational purposes. Except as otherwise provided by law, a nonconformity, including the lawful use or occupation of land or premises existing at the time of the adoption of an official control under this chapter, may be continued, including through repair, replacement, restoration, maintenance, or improvement, but not including expansion.
